Key Buying Factors for Racing Simulator Shifter for Xbox

Compatibility

Not every shifter works with Xbox on its own. Some connect directly to the console through a compatible wheel base, while others are PC-only unless bundled with an Xbox-supported wheel. Check whether the shifter is native Xbox compatible or requires a matching ecosystem.

Shift Pattern and Modes

H-pattern shifters are the most common choice for road cars, vintage vehicles, and immersive cruising. Sequential shifters are better for motorsport-style driving where quick upshifts and downshifts matter. A dual-mode unit gives you the most flexibility.

Build Quality and Feel

Metal components, firmer gates, and solid internal resistance usually create a more convincing shift feel. A shifter that feels too light can be less satisfying over time, especially in longer endurance sessions.

Mounting and Desk Stability

Stable mounting matters as much as realism. Look for clamp compatibility, rigid construction, and a layout that fits your wheel stand or desk. A great-feeling shifter is less useful if it slides around during hard shifts.

Who Should Buy What

Choose a standalone shifter if you already own an Xbox-compatible wheel and want to upgrade realism without replacing the whole setup. Choose a bundle if you’re starting from scratch and want the simplest path to a complete rig.

If you mainly play road-focused or classic-car titles, prioritize H-pattern feel and reverse lockout. If you’re into rally, touring cars, or mixed discipline racing, a shifter with sequential capability or a more versatile wheel bundle may be the smarter pick. For most buyers, the best Racing Simulator Shifter for Xbox is the one that matches both your game library and your current hardware, not just the most expensive option.
